[Freeswitch-users] need more variables which xml_curl module sends

Zohair Raza engineerzuhairraza at gmail.com
Sun Feb 19 10:17:48 MSK 2012


Hi,

They are already available in xml_curl POST, here is the complete post from
freeswitch

Also, if you need any custom variable, you can export using export
application and get it in xml_cdr

[hostname=zuhair.host&section=dialplan&tag_name=&key_name=&
key_value=&Event-Name=REQUEST_PARAMS&Core-UUID=24d6453e-
6280-4da3-92cc-176906e77c11&FreeSWITCH-Hostname=zuhair.host&
FreeSWITCH-IPv4=74.55.2.196&FreeSWITCH-IPv6=%3A%3A1&Event-
Date-Local=2010-07-27%2007%3A02%3A45&Event-Date-GMT=Tue,%
2027%20Jul%202010%2012%3A02%3A45%20GMT&Event-Date-
Timestamp=1280232165300887&Event-Calling-File=mod_
dialplan_xml.c&Event-Calling-Function=dialplan_xml_locate&
Event-Calling-Line-Number=302&Channel-State=CS_ROUTING&
Channel-Call-State=RINGING&Channel-State-Number=2&
Channel-Name=sofia/external/5555%4074.55.2.196&Unique-
ID=81511956-8239-4ddb-86ac-637fdd1cb784&Call-Direction=
inbound&Presence-Call-Direction=inbound&Answer-State=ringing&Channel-Read-
Codec-Name=PCMU&Channel-Read-Codec-Rate=8000&Channel-Write-
Codec-Name=PCMU&Channel-Write-Codec-Rate=8000&Caller-
Username=5555&Caller-Dialplan=XML&Caller-Caller-ID-Name=
5555&Caller-Caller-ID-Number=
5555&Caller-Network-Addr=67.156.22.129&Caller-ANI=5555&
Caller-Destination-Number=009922&Caller-Unique-ID=81511956-8239-4ddb-86ac-
637fdd1cb784&Caller-Source=mod_sofia&Caller-Context=
public&Caller-Channel-Name=
sofia/external/5555%4074.55.2.196&Caller-Profile-Index=
1&Caller-Profile-Created-Time=1280232165298602&Caller-Channel-Created-Time=
1280232165298602&Caller-Channel-Answered-Time=0&
Caller-Channel-Progress-Time=0&Caller-Channel-Progress-
Media-Time=0&Caller-Channel-Hangup-Time=0&Caller-Channel-
Transfer-Time=0&Caller-Screen-Bit=false&Caller-Privacy-Hide-
Name=false&Caller-Privacy-Hide-Number=false&variable_
direction=inbound&variable_uuid=81511956-8239-4ddb-86ac-
637fdd1cb784&variable_sip_
local_network_addr=74.55.2.196&variable_sip_network_ip=
67.156.22.129&variable_sip_network_port=8891&variable_
sip_received_ip=67.156.22.129&variable_sip_received_port=
8891&variable_sip_via_protocol=udp&variable_sip_from_user=5555&variable_sip_
from_uri=5555%4074.55.2.196&
variable_sip_from_host=74.55.2.196&variable_sip_from_
user_stripped=5555&variable_sip_from_tag=as1c181535&
variable_sofia_profile_name=external&variable_sip_Remote-
Party-ID=%225555%22%20%3Csip%3A5555%4074.55.2.196%3E%
3Bprivacy%3Doff%3Bscreen%3Dno&variable_sip_cid_type=rpid&
variable_sip_full_via=SIP/2.0/UDP%2067.156.22.129%3A8891%
3Bbranch%3Dz9hG4bK3577a299%3Brport%3D8891&variable_sip_
from_display=5555&variable_sip_full_from=%225555%22%20%
3Csip%3A5555%4074.55.2.196%3E%3Btag%3Das1c181535&
variable_sip_full_to=%3Csip%3A009922%4074.55.2.196%
3A5080%3E&variable_sip_req_user=009922&variable_sip_req_
port=5080&variable_sip_req_uri=009922%4074.55.2.196%
3A5080&variable_sip_req_host=74.55.2.196&variable_sip_to_
user=009922&variable_sip_to_port=5080&variable_sip_to_uri=
009922%4074.55.2.196%3A5080&
variable_sip_to_host=74.55.2.196&variable_sip_contact_
user=5555&variable_sip_contact_port=8891&variable_
sip_contact_uri=5555%4067.156.22.129%3A8891&variable_sip_
contact_host=67.156.22.129&variable_channel_name=sofia/
external/5555%4074.55.2.196&variable_sip_call_id=
2d094fc97c51425911a7bc38726184f2%4074.55.2.196&variable_
sip_user_agent=Asterisk%20PBX&
variable_sip_via_host=67.156.22.129&variable_sip_via_port=
8891&variable_sip_via_rport=8891&variable_max_forwards=70&
variable_switch_r_sdp=v%3D0%0D%0Ao%3Droot%2019280%2019280%
20IN%20IP4%2067.156.22.129%0D%0As%3Dsession%0D%0Ac%3DIN%
20IP4%2067.156.22.129%0D%0At%3D0%200%0D%0Am%3Daudio%
2018762%20RTP/AVP%200%20101%0D%0Aa%3Drtpmap%3A0%20PCMU/
8000%0D%0Aa%3Drtpmap%3A101%20telephone-event/8000%0D%0Aa%
3Dfmtp%3A101%200-16%0D%0Aa%3DsilenceSupp%3Aoff%20-%20-%
20-%20-%0D%0Aa%3Dptime%3A20%0D%0A&variable_remote_media_
ip=67.156.22.129&variable_remote_media_port=18762&
variable_sip_use_codec_name=PCMU&variable_sip_use_codec_
rate=8000&variable_sip_use_codec_ptime=20&variable_read_
codec=PCMU&variable_read_rate=8000&variable_write_codec=
PCMU&variable_write_rate=8000&variable_endpoint_disposition=
RECEIVED&Hunt-Username=5555&Hunt-Dialplan=XML&Hunt-Caller-
ID-Name=5555&Hunt-Caller-ID-Number=5555&Hunt-Network-Addr=
67.156.22.129&Hunt-ANI=5555&Hunt-Destination-Number=009922&Hunt-Unique-ID=
81511956-8239-4ddb-86ac-637fdd1cb784&Hunt-Source=mod_
sofia&Hunt-Context=public&Hunt-Channel-Name=sofia/
external/5555%4074.55.2.196&Hunt-Profile-Index=1&Hunt-Profile-Created-Time=
1280232165298602&Hunt-Channel-Created-Time=1280232165298602&
Hunt-Channel-Answered-Time=0&Hunt-Channel-Progress-Time=0&
Hunt-Channel-Progress-Media-Time=0&Hunt-Channel-Hangup-
Time=0&Hunt-Channel-Transfer-Time=0&Hunt-Screen-Bit=false&
Hunt-Privacy-Hide-Name=false&Hunt-Privacy-Hide-Number=false]


Regards,
Zohair Raza

2012/2/17 Yuriy Nasida <nasida at live.ru>

>  Hello FS users,
>
> I search some way for recieving more variables which my php script
> recieves in array - $_REQUEST from xml_curl module (it is intralanman's
> scripts) in case of recieving sip message - REGISTER from some sip device.
>
> I see list of variables:
> http://wiki.freeswitch.org/wiki/Mod_xml_curl#Authorization
>
> But, I need more. For example I need to know source sip port of endpoint.
> Also I have to know full SIP contact header from REGISTER request.
>
> Please advise.
> Thanks.
>
>
> _________________________________________________________________________
> Professional FreeSWITCH Consulting Services:
> consulting at freeswitch.org
> http://www.freeswitchsolutions.com
>
> 
> 
>
> Official FreeSWITCH Sites
> http://www.freeswitch.org
> http://wiki.freeswitch.org
> http://www.cluecon.com
>
> FreeSWITCH-users mailing list
> FreeSWITCH-users at lists.freeswitch.org
> http://lists.freeswitch.org/mailman/listinfo/freeswitch-users
> UNSUBSCRIBE:http://lists.freeswitch.org/mailman/options/freeswitch-users
> http://www.freeswitch.org
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20120219/b25ee6ba/attachment-0001.html 


Join us at ClueCon 2011 Aug 9-11, 2011
More information about the FreeSWITCH-users mailing list